C) Life expectancy and literacy rate.The AP Human Geography exam contains two sections and lasts for two hours and 15 minutes. The first section includes 60 multiple-choice questions; students are given 60 minutes to complete this portion of the exam. In the remaining 75 minutes, students answer three free-response essay questions. AP Human Geography AMSCO Unit 1spatial approach - correct answers The way of identifying, explaining, and predicting the human and physical patterns and the connections of various locations. physical geography - correct answers the branch of …Frequency of which something exists within a given unit of area. Example: Population. Diffusion. Process of spread of a feature or trend from one place to another over time. Example: Seeds spread from trees. Distance Decay. Contact diminishes with increasing distance and eventually disappears. Example: Friend moves away, you don't talk as much ...All lines of latitude and longitude meet at right angles. Mercator Map has Greenland appearing to be a similar size to Africa, although Africa is much bigger. Robinson …All of the vocab words from unit 2 of AP Human Geography.
